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en West Madison

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en West Madison?

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en West Madison está en The Canyons listado en $641.

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en West Madison?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en West Madison es $1,789.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en West Madison 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en West Madison es una unidad de 1,164 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,325 en Bloom Monona Apartments.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en West Madison?

El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en West Madison es actualmente de 677 pies cuadrados.
